Subject: Scheduled key rotation — StageGrid seat-map renderer

Team,

As part of the quarterly credential cycle at Velvetline Theatres, the StageGrid seat-map renderer's upstream key was rotated this morning. The old key is revoked effective immediately; any cached copies in the render workers should be flushed. Staging and production were updated in lockstep, so no config drift is expected. For your audit records, the new key is as follows.

service key, yadug-bajog: zpat3_pou

Runbook fragment 7.3 — Returned demo units. All Cloverline demo consoles coming back from the Westharrow showroom must be logged against the loan register before they enter the storeroom. Check serial plates against the outbound list, note any missing cables or damage, and photograph each unit on arrival. Units flagged for refurbishment go to the caged shelf only. The collecting courier should be given the hand-over instruction below.

courier memo of tawep-tajep: the quenius ulaiel courier leaves the fenir ledger at gate 9128 under passcode 527513

## Authentication — Firmware Update Channel (BrightNest Devices)

Support agents pushing a firmware build to the beta channel must authenticate against the OtaForge internal API. Devices only accept builds signed through this channel, so manual file transfers will fail validation. Channel promotions (beta → stable) require a second approver in the console. To enqueue a build for a device group, call OtaForge with the key below.

gateway credential: kto23_LX9A4ys6i4nzHtpOLNLodKK

Quick note for assistants at Verlow & Tane: when your visitors arrive, point them to the guest Wi-Fi desk by the reception planters — it's self-service and pretty painless. If the desk attendant has stepped away, the backup tablet is in the drawer, which opens with the reception pass code.

staff pass of kawip-hawef = bdg-QLP-2

Welcome to on-call for the Glimmerpane design system! Our snapshot tests live in the `snapcheck` suite and run on every merge to main. If a UI component changes visually, the diff bot flags it — usually it's an intentional tweak, so just approve the new baseline. If it's 2am and snapshots are failing across the board, it's almost always a font-loading race, not your problem. To unlock the baseline store and re-approve snapshots in bulk, use the recovery passphrase below.

recovery phrase for tahag-taguf: wenix-caswyn